
BALFOUR BEATTY JOINT VENTURE AWARDED NETWORK RAIL SIGNALLING FRAMEWORKS
Balfour Beatty, the international infrastructure group, announces that Signalling Solutions Limited (SSL), its 50/50 joint venture with Alstom, has been successful in the tendering process for the new signalling frameworks on behalf of Network Rail.
SSL has secured involvement in seven of the eight geographical regions covered by Network Rail's seven year "New Signalling Frameworks", worth a total £1.5bn. In three of these regions, Central East, Great Western Inner and Great Western Outer, SSL is primary supplier and in 4 geographical regions, Scotland, Central West, Wales and Western and Kent & Anglia, SSL is secondary supplier.
The company will introduce innovative train control systems and new collaborative methods of working to ensure that the cost reduction measures required to achieve the industry targets agreed by Network Rail with the Office of Rail Regulation are met.
